Assigned By HM The Sultan, Endowments Minister Leads Oman’s Delegation To Peace Meet In Paris

Paris: Under the delegation of His Majesty Sultan Haitham bin Tarik, Dr. Mohammed Said Al Ma’amari, the Minister of Endowments and Religious Affairs, led the delegation of the Sultanate of Oman to the "International Meeting for Peace" held in Paris, under the auspices of the theme "Imagine Peace." The conference is scheduled to conclude on the 24th of September, 2024.

During the proceedings, Dr. Mohammed extended the greetings of His Majesty Sultan Haitham bin Tarik to the attendees, alongside expressing His Majesty the Sultan's earnest wishes for the success of the conference.

Dr. Mohammed emphasized that the Sultanate of Oman places a high priority on peace, citing the state's Basic Law of the State, which states that "peace is the goal of the state." He affirmed that Oman is steadfast in its commitment to a global vision that supports the realization of this goal.

"In the Sultanate of Oman, owing to our heritage of flexibility and wisdom deeply ingrained in our history, we have recognized the immense value of human connections and the exchange of knowledge and experiences. We have dedicated ourselves to nurturing a spirit of friendship, understanding, respect, and coexistence with all, grounded in the belief that we are not solitary entities but are part of a global community, interconnected and bound by humanitarian goals and a shared destiny,” Dr. Mohammed elaborated.

He further stated that, through a steadfast commitment to this humanitarian approach, His Majesty Sultan Haitham bin Tarik has affirmed the Sultanate of Oman's position as a beacon of human relations and peace.

"In line with these principles, we in the Sultanate of Oman, in collaboration with the Ministry of Endowments and Religious Affairs, have initiated a series of projects aimed at fostering dialogue between religions and cultures, and promoting the values of tolerance, understanding, and coexistence," Dr. Mohammed added.

The minister highlighted that the international peace meeting takes place at a critical juncture in global history, marked by significant repercussions and profound transformations. We are currently experiencing a period of historical significance, where the conflict between forces advocating for discord and division and those advocating for unity and cohesion has reached a critical turning point, Dr. Mohammed noted. He emphasized that this conflict underscores the importance of recognizing that the consequences of our actions today will echo across present and future generations.

The Minister observed that individuals contemplating the current state of the world would discern a profound contradiction within the notion of peace. "We, as human beings, have developed technologies intended to benefit the global populace, alongside international communication networks designed to foster closer connections among individuals, and institutions committed to the construction and maintenance of peace," he stated.

He elaborated that the world and its societies are confronted with fresh and evolving challenges. These challenges encompass cyber-attacks aimed at destabilizing nations and undermining public trust in their institutions through the dissemination of false news and information. Additionally, ideological and intellectual extremism, unsatisfied with mere theoretical disagreements, advocate for discord, violence, and the violation of international treaties and covenants to meddle in the affairs of societies and infringe upon their privacy, the Minister noted. These issues transcend physical boundaries, challenging both the theoretical and practical frameworks of stability, development, and the culture of peace.

The Minister emphasized, "It is imperative that peace assumes a central role and is realized as a concrete reality; it is time for all parties to acknowledge that the path to achieving this reality is paved by our actions, words, and our readiness to bridge divides." He called for a renewed dedication to this noble humanitarian cause.

Upon concluding his speech, Dr. Mohammed expressed his hope that this assembly would serve as a catalyst for writing a new chapter in the annals of history for our world. He envisioned a future where peace is not merely an exception but a fundamental principle from which future generations could derive the values of brotherhood, solidarity, and cooperation. This vision would guide us towards a brighter, more secure, and peaceful future.
